Bipasha Basu, Karan Singh Grover and daughter Devi celebrate Diwali, calling it the ‘best kind of party’ - WATCH VIDEO

Bipasha Basu celebrated Diwali with husband Karan Singh Grover and daughter Devi, sharing a heartfelt video of their puja, aarti, and joyful dancing. Fans praised their festive moments. The couple married in 2016 and welcomed Devi in 2022. Bipasha has taken a break from acting since marriage.

Diwali celebrations continue to light up Bollywood. Celebrities have welcomed the festival in their own special ways, some with lavish parties, while others enjoyed quiet moments at home with family, performing pujas and traditional customs. Among them is Bipasha Basu, who always embraces life’s simple pleasures, especially during festivals, alongside her husband Karan Singh Grover and their daughter Devi. Known for sharing glimpses of their family life, she gave fans a charming look at their Diwali festivities.

Beautiful family moments in video

The actress posted a video that captured beautiful moments of her and Karan with their daughter during Diwali. It shows them performing traditional puja, offering flowers to Goddess Lakshmi and Lord Ganesh, and doing aarti together. The family is also seen joyfully dancing, with their daughter Devi clearly enjoying the celebrations. Alongside their little girl shining in the festivities, the couple shared tender moments, including a sweet kiss on Bipasha’s cheek. The actress also lit diyas arranged in colorful flower rangolis. The trio embraced the festival in style, wearing coordinated traditional clothes, Bipasha and Devi in vibrant pink outfits, and Karan in a green kurta. Sharing the video, Bipasha Basu captioned it, “Best kind of Diwali party. Thank you, God. Sending love and light to all.”

Marriage and family life

On April 30, 2016, Bipasha Basu and actor Karan Singh Grover exchanged vows in a traditional Bengali wedding. They became parents to their daughter Devi in November 2022.

Professional break from acting

Bipasha has been away from acting since she got married. Her last film role was a brief cameo in the 2018 comedy ‘Welcome To New York’. Go to Source
